Luteolin Powder – 98%
Luteolin is a yellow flavone found in celery, parsley, chamomile and peanut hulls, typically extracted from peanut shells or other botanicals. It is valued for antioxidant and neuro-supportive research interest.

How to Use / Dosage
- Typical daily intake: 50-200 mg/day
- Typical use level: 1-30% in capsules and tablets; 0.05-0.5% in cosmetics
- Formulation tip: Dose on the assay value stated on the CoA; many polyphenol actives benefit from light and oxygen protection.
- Weigh accurately and pre-blend small quantities with a carrier (e.g. maltodextrin, MCC or rice flour) for uniform distribution.
- Final dosage should be based on the lot-specific Certificate of Analysis, the target serving size and the rules of your destination market.

Storage & Handling
Store tightly sealed in a cool (below 25 °C), dry place, protected from light and oxygen.. Keep container tightly closed; use clean, dry utensils. Shelf life is typically 24 months in unopened original packaging (see CoA).
Regulatory Note
Luteolin is used as a dietary ingredient in the US; isolated luteolin may require Novel Food assessment in the EU. Verify destination market.

Caution & Disclaimer
- Avoid in pregnancy and breastfeeding due to insufficient safety data
- May interact with drugs metabolised by CYP enzymes
- Peanut-hull derived grades – confirm allergen status
- Low oral bioavailability
